AbstractUltrafast photoinduced electron injection and subsequent relaxation steps of the indoline dye D149 were investigated for mesoporous thin films using pump–supercontinuum probe (PSCP) transient absorption spectroscopy in the range 370–770 nm. Three types of mesoporous ZnO layers were compared: Electrodeposited ZnO thin films prepared by using the structure-directing agents (1) Eosin Y (EY) and (2) Coumarin 343 (C343), which are known to produce ZnO layers of different morphology; and (3) mesoporous ZnO thin films consisting of sintered nanoparticles with a diameter of 20 nm.
